Matousec still ranks Comodo & Online Armor at the top, no surprise.
http://www.matousec.com/projects/firewall-...nge/results.php What surprises me is one newcomer, Netchina S3 2008. Since it comes from China, no surprise coz they do have the Great Firewall of China. PC Tools Firewall Plus is also surprising since the older test ranks them as the worst, huge improvements for them to climb the charts drastically. |
